Thanks for looking.
I use just dponts sunsky because I can see sun in viewport. Physical sky in kray is good but hard to point direction.
No other lights. Bake and rendered less than 1min/frame in q6600.
Characters and shadows rendered separately then composite in AE.

Cut your car into pieces. Parent them to a rig and create two keyframes one with tpose,how your robot looks like, and the other in the car mode. I have my tpose robot in keyframe 0 and car mode in keyframe 1. So if there's a shot I could just keyframe a tpose at frame 40 and pose my character to something I want, then do the inbetween from carmode to frame 40.
